The Attendance Officer will play a central role in monitoring and improving attendance across the school. You will work closely with senior leaders, Heads of Year, pastoral staff, parents and carers to identify attendance concerns early and put appropriate support in place.
The role requires someone who can work confidently with attendance information and communicate effectively with families. You will monitor daily registers, follow up unexplained absences and ensure attendance records are accurate and up to date.
You will be responsible for contacting parents and carers regarding absence and punctuality, identifying emerging attendance patterns and escalating concerns in line with school procedures. Where students require additional support, you will work with pastoral colleagues to develop appropriate attendance interventions.
The successful candidate will also assist with attendance meetings, prepare reports for senior leaders and maintain detailed records of actions taken. You may be required to liaise with external professionals and agencies where attendance concerns become more significant.
This position would suit someone who is calm, persistent and confident when having difficult conversations while remaining approachable and supportive. Building positive relationships with students and families will be an important part of the role.

Attendance Officer - Responsibilities
The successful candidate will be responsible for:
Monitoring daily student attendance
Checking and following up unexplained absences
Completing first-day contact procedures
Maintaining accurate attendance records
Monitoring lateness and persistent absence
Identifying patterns and trends within attendance data
Contacting parents and carers regarding attendance concerns
Arranging and supporting attendance meetings
Preparing attendance reports for senior leaders
Recording interventions and agreed actions
Working closely with Heads of Year and pastoral staff
Supporting safeguarding procedures where attendance raises concerns
Liaising with external agencies when appropriate
Supporting attendance improvement initiatives
Promoting good attendance and punctuality across the school
You will need to be comfortable working with confidential information and understand the importance of handling sensitive family circumstances professionally.
